When we chart our 4 equity ETFs for relative performance, we’re starting 3 months prior and watching the trendline for each fund as it progresses to the end date. Just as every race begins at the starting line, all 4 ETFs begin at the 0.0% line. The one thing constant throughout the 3-month “race” is that 0.0% line. Should all 4 ETFs end the race below that 0.0% line, it indicates that each fund lost value compared to holding an asset that generated zero returns.

What generates zero returns? Cash. And our relative performance test predicts that the trends on the chart will continue ‒ at least for the better part of the upcoming month. So we go to cash.
